Abstract:
Mining is a basic industry of the national economy. In the past for a long time, they were not conducive to the high-quality development of the mining industry which one-sided emphasis on geological factors without paying attention to technical and economic evaluation, and the extensive mining development destroyed the environment. Based on the model of double control and reasonable domain of mineral exploration, the proposed quaternion model for mining development believes that geology, technology, economy, and environment are the four basic factors influencing and controlling mining activities, which run through the entire process of mineral exploration and development. The geological reliability is the foundation, technical feasibility is the guarantee, economic profitability is the prerequisite, and environmental protection is the principle. Only when geological conditions are favorable and resource reserves are reliable, mining, selection and smelting technologies are feasible, expected economic benefits are significant and investment risks are controllable, and environmental protection requirements are met, the mining can achieve innovative, green, coordinated, and sustainable development. Mineral exploration and development must comply with regulations and be legal, and the connotation of “quaternion” model must be complied with legal provisions.
